May is National Moving Month and the start of the busiest time of year for changing residencies…which means unlicensed movers and dishonest scammers are waiting to take advantage of consumers who aren’t careful. In 2011, BBB received more than 1.3 million moving-related inquiries and more than 9,000 complaints against movers.

Whether you are looking to replace your home’s windows, install new siding on your garage, or build a pool for the summer, it’s critical to find a reliable home contractor. In 2011, BBB received over 6,000 complaints against general contractors, which was 11% more than the previous year.
